Ladies Cardigans Knitted in King Cole Cotton Top DK – Pattern 5375

This King Cole pattern 5375 is a downloadable PDF for knitting ladies cardigans in King Cole Cotton Top DK yarn. Designed at an intermediate difficulty level, this pattern offers a range of sizes from 81 cm to 127 cm (32 in to 50 in) bust measurement, making it accessible to a wide variety of body types. The pattern is a great choice for knitters who are comfortable with basic techniques and ready to explore more structured garment construction, including the use of cable panels.

Yarn and Materials

  • Yarn: King Cole Cotton Top DK
  • Yarn Weight: Double Knit (DK)
  • Needles: 4 mm needles, or the size required to achieve the correct tension
  • Cable Needle (CN): Required for working the cable panel sections

As with all King Cole patterns, knitters are encouraged to check their tension carefully before beginning. If fewer stitches than stated are achieved, thinner needles should be used; if more stitches are achieved, thicker needles are recommended. Getting tension right is especially important in garment knitting to ensure the correct fit across the full size range.

Tension

  • Cable panel: 16 stitches measures 5 cm (2 in)
  • Main pattern tension: 23 stitches and 30 rows to 10 cm (4 in) over pattern on 4 mm needles
  • Stocking stitch tension: 21 stitches and 28 rows to 10 cm (4 in) on 4 mm needles

Techniques Used

This is an intermediate knitting pattern, meaning knitters should have a solid foundation in basic knitting before attempting it. The following techniques are referenced within the pattern:

  • Cable knitting — using a cable needle (CN) to cross stitches and create a raised, twisted rope-like texture. Cables are a classic knitting technique that add visual interest and structure to garments.
  • Make 1 (m1) — a common increase technique where a stitch is created by picking up the horizontal strand between the last stitch worked and the next stitch, then working into the back of it to avoid a hole.
  • Decreasing (dec) — reducing stitch counts to shape the garment, particularly around armholes, necklines, and other fitted areas.
  • Slip 1 knitways (s1) — slipping a stitch knitwise, often used in decrease combinations or edge treatments.
  • Working through the back of the loop (tbl) — a technique used to twist stitches, often employed alongside increases or in textured stitch patterns.
  • Stocking stitch — the classic knit-on-right-side, purl-on-wrong-side fabric used as a base fabric in many sections of the cardigan.
